Ravioli Recipe

Ingredients

– 2 cups all-purpose flour
– 3 large eggs
– 1 teaspoon salt
– 1 tablespoon olive oil
– 1 cup ricotta cheese
– 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
– 1 egg yolk
– Salt and pepper to taste
– Marinara sauce for serving

Servings and Cooking Time

This recipe serves 4 people. Preparation time is approximately 30 minutes, and cooking time is about 10-15 minutes.

Nutritional Value

Each serving (1/4 of the recipe) contains approximately 400 calories, 20g of protein, 30g of carbohydrates, and 25g of fat.

Step-by-Step Cooking Process

  • In a large bowl, mix the flour and salt.
  • Create a well in the center and add eggs and olive oil.
  • Gradually incorporate the flour into the eggs until a dough forms.
  • Knead the dough on a floured surface for about 10 minutes.
  • Wrap the dough in plastic wrap and let it rest for 30 minutes.
  • In another bowl, combine ricotta, Parmesan, egg yolk, salt, and pepper.
  • Roll out the dough into thin sheets using a pasta machine.
  • Cut the sheets into squares, adding a spoonful of filling in the center of each.
  • Fold the squares over and seal the edges with water.
  • Boil the ravioli in salted water for about 4 minutes, then serve with marinara sauce.

Alternative Ingredients

You can substitute all-purpose flour with semolina flour for a different texture. Additionally, feel free to use spinach or butternut squash in the filling for a unique twist.

Serving and Pairings

Serve your ravioli with marinara sauce, fresh basil, or a drizzle of olive oil. It pairs well with a side salad or garlic bread for a complete meal.

Storage and Reheating

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, simply boil or microwave until warmed through. Ravioli can also be frozen before cooking for later use.

Cooking Mistakes

  • Overworking the dough can lead to tough pasta.
  • Not sealing ravioli properly can cause filling to leak.
  • Using too much filling can make them hard to seal.
  • Cooking ravioli in unsalted water affects the flavor.
  • Letting the pasta dry out can make it difficult to work with.

Helpful Tips

  • Use a pasta machine for even thickness.
  • Chill the filling before using for easier handling.
  • Experiment with different sauces for variety.
  • Make a double batch to freeze for later meals.

FAQs

Can I use store-bought pasta for this recipe?

Yes, you can use store-bought pasta sheets to save time, but homemade pasta adds a special touch.

How do I know when the ravioli are cooked?

Ravioli are cooked when they float to the surface of the boiling water, usually in about 4 minutes.

Can I make ravioli ahead of time?

Absolutely! You can prepare ravioli in advance and store them in the refrigerator or freeze them before cooking.

What sauces pair well with ravioli?

Marinara, Alfredo, and brown butter sage sauce are all excellent choices to complement ravioli.

How do I prevent my ravioli from sticking together?

Dust the ravioli with flour before cooking and avoid overcrowding them in the pot.
